Analysis

Turks and Caicos Islands recorded 0.0902 for life expectancy versus lifespan inequality in 2023. That is the lowest value across all 74 years on record.

Compared with earlier readings it is down 0.3% on the previous year and down 4.2% over ten years.

Over the whole period, life expectancy versus lifespan inequality in Turks and Caicos Islands peaked at 0.3104 in 1950 and was at its lowest, 0.0902, in 2023.

Turks and Caicos Islands ranks 149th of 236 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 74 years of available data.
